Abstract

Paclitaxel given every 2 weeks induces major tumor regression in the majority of patients with advanced KS who failed to respond to previous systemic chemotherapy. Paclitaxel is associated with significant improvement in quality of life with acceptable toxicity and should be considered as an effective treatment option for patients with advanced KS.
